What to Look for in a Camera for Wedding Photography

Here are the most important features to consider when selecting a wedding photography camera:

  1. High Resolution – A high megapixel count ensures crisp details and allows for cropping while maintaining image quality.
  2. Excellent Low-Light Performance – Weddings often involve dimly lit venues, so a high ISO range with low noise is essential.
  3. Fast & Accurate Autofocus – Weddings are fast-paced, and a reliable autofocus system ensures sharp images of moving subjects.
  4. Dual Card Slots – Redundancy is critical in professional work, ensuring you don’t lose precious wedding memories.
  5. 4K Video Capabilities – Many wedding photographers also shoot videos, so high-quality 4K recording is a great advantage.

Top 5 Cameras for Wedding Photography

1. Canon EOS R6 Mark IIBest All-Round Wedding Camera

The Canon EOS R6 Mark II is a full-frame mirrorless camera that excels in low-light conditions and offers blazing-fast autofocus.

Best Camera for Wedding Photography

Key Features:

24.2 MP Full-Frame Sensor – Provides excellent image quality and dynamic range.
Dual Pixel CMOS AF II – Tracks subjects with precision, even in low light.
ISO Range: 100-102,400 – Handles dark venues and nighttime receptions effortlessly.
40 fps Burst Shooting (Electronic Shutter) – Perfect for capturing fleeting emotions.
4K 60fps Video Recording – Great for wedding videography.

Why It’s Great for Weddings:
The R6 Mark II offers superb autofocus, excellent ISO performance, and fast burst shooting, making it one of the most reliable wedding photography cameras.

2. Sony Alpha a7 IVBest Mirrorless for Wedding Photography

The Sony Alpha a7 IV combines outstanding image quality with a robust autofocus system, making it a favorite among wedding photographers.

Best Mirrorless for Wedding Photography

Key Features:

33 MP Full-Frame Sensor – Delivers sharp and detailed images.
Real-Time Eye Autofocus – Tracks faces and eyes seamlessly.
ISO 100-51,200 (Expandable to 204,800) – Excellent low-light performance.
10 fps Continuous Shooting – Captures fast-moving wedding moments.
4K 60fps Video – Ideal for hybrid photo/video shooters.

Why It’s Great for Weddings:
With its high-resolution sensor, precise autofocus, and powerful video capabilities, the Sony a7 IV is a top-tier choice for professionals.

3. Nikon Z8Best High Resolution Camera for Wedding Photography

The Nikon Z8 is a powerful full-frame mirrorless camera that offers stunning image quality and video performance.

Best High Resolution Camera for Wedding Photography

Key Features:

45.7 MP Full-Frame Sensor – Ensures ultra-detailed wedding portraits.
493-Point Autofocus System – Tracks subjects accurately.
ISO 64-25,600 (Expandable to 102,400) – Delivers stunning low-light performance.
20 fps Continuous RAW Shooting – Ensures you never miss a moment.
8K and 4K 120fps Video – Perfect for high-end wedding videography.

Why It’s Great for Weddings:
With a high-resolution sensor and incredible dynamic range, the Nikon Z8 is ideal for photographers who want unparalleled detail and flexibility in post-processing.

4. Canon EOS 5D Mark IVBest DSLR for Wedding Photography

If you prefer DSLRs, the Canon EOS 5D Mark IV remains one of the best cameras for wedding photography.

Best DSLR for Wedding Photography

Key Features:

30.4 MP Full-Frame Sensor – Produces rich, high-quality images.
61-Point Autofocus System – Ensures accurate subject tracking.
ISO 100-32,000 (Expandable to 102,400) – Performs well in low light.
7 fps Burst Shooting – Captures crucial wedding moments.
4K Video Recording – Ideal for videography professionals.

Why It’s Great for Weddings:
The 5D Mark IV’s reliability, battery life, and image quality make it a go-to DSLR for many wedding photographers.

5. Fujifilm X-T5Best APS-C Camera for Wedding Photography

For those who prefer a compact and lightweight camera, the Fujifilm X-T5 is an excellent APS-C mirrorless camera with pro-level features.

Best APS-C Camera for Wedding Photography

Key Features:

40.2 MP APS-C Sensor – Offers high-resolution images in a smaller body.
Film Simulation Modes – Delivers stunning in-camera colors.
7-Stop In-Body Stabilization – Reduces shake in low-light shots.
20 fps Continuous Shooting – Great for capturing action shots.
4K 60fps Video Recording – Ideal for wedding filmmakers.

Why It’s Great for Weddings:
The Fujifilm X-T5 is lightweight yet powerful, perfect for wedding photographers who want stunning image quality in a compact package.

Conclusion

Choosing the best camera for wedding photography depends on your needs and budget.

  • For all-around performance, go with the Canon EOS R6 Mark II.
  • For professionals seeking high resolution, the Nikon Z8 or Sony a7 IV are top choices.
  • For those who prefer DSLRs, the Canon 5D Mark IV is a proven workhorse.
  • For a compact and budget-friendly option, the Fujifilm X-T5 is a great pick.
